Undercoat Paint For Epoxy. To properly prepare a porous surface for epoxy application, it is recommended to thoroughly clean the surface and seal it by skim coating. Epoxy primers are used to waterproof and therefore protect bare metal from oxidation problems. Skim coating seals the surface and prevents your substrate from soaking up the epoxy and air bubbles from forming during your flood pour. 1m+ visitors in the past month Our undercoat is a mixture of primer and paint, which works as a base coat for the surface of your epoxy project. One easy way to remember is if a surface is painted use an undercoat, if it's new, use a primer.
